Punjab Kings Win Toss, Elect to Bowl First in IPL 2026 Match Against Sunrisers Hyderabad
In the 17th match of the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2026, Punjab Kings (PBKS) won the toss and decided to bowl first against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) on Saturday. The decision to chase was influenced by the afternoon conditions and the team's recent performance while batting second.
Shreyas Iyer Explains Bowling First Decision
PBKS captain Shreyas Iyer elaborated on the choice, stating, "We're going to bowl first. It's a day game, and we obviously want to get a knack of how the wicket is going to play and have a fair idea. But other than that, that's what we've been doing in the last couple of games. We've been thriving on that." He emphasized the importance of adapting to conditions and supporting the team's younger players.
Iyer added, "I personally feel that you can't control the nature of the weather. You've just got to go with the flow. And I personally feel that we don't have to address anything at any point in time. Just back each other, back all the youngsters in the team. The more you tell them, the more confusing it gets for them. So, it's better that they live in their own nature and express themselves." He confirmed one change in the lineup, with Priyansh Arya replacing Nehal Wadhera.
Ishan Kishan Confident Despite Bowling Second
Stand-in SRH captain Ishan Kishan acknowledged that his team would have preferred to bowl first but remained optimistic. He said, "We would have loved to bowl first. But yeah, I think the wicket looks pretty hard to me. And it's about playing good cricket in the first innings." Kishan highlighted the challenge of missing key bowler Pat Cummins but expressed faith in the young squad.
Kishan noted, "Obviously, it's a big disadvantage for any team, Pat is a tremendous bowler. He gets on with an experience of his. But still, I feel we've got a young side, young bowlers today in the team. And hopefully, we'll just try and execute the plans, which is the most important thing in T20 cricket." SRH made two changes, with Salil Arora replacing Liam Livingstone and Praful Hinge making his debut in place of Jaydev Unadkat.
Playing XIs and Impact Subs for PBKS vs SRH
Punjab Kings (Playing XI): Priyansh Arya, Prabhsimran Singh (wicketkeeper), Cooper Connolly, Shreyas Iyer (captain), Shashank Singh, Marcus Stoinis, Marco Jansen, Xavier Bartlett, Vijaykumar Vyshak, Arshdeep Singh, Yuzvendra Chahal.
Sunrisers Hyderabad (Playing XI): Travis Head, Abhishek Sharma, Ishan Kishan (wicketkeeper and captain), Heinrich Klaasen, Salil Arora, Aniket Verma, Nitish Kumar Reddy, Harsh Dubey, Shivang Kumar, Harshal Patel, Eshan Malinga.
Impact Subs:
- Sunrisers Hyderabad: Jaydev Unadkat, Liam Livingstone, Shivam Mavi, Praful Hinge, Kamindu Mendis.
- Punjab Kings: Nehal Wadhera, Vishnu Vinod, Suryansh Shedge, Yash Thakur, Harpreet Brar.
